Every year, at the end of May, we have a race for life event.
The children each get a passport, made for the children as a keepsake by the PTA.
The children run around the school field choosing to either complete 1 or 2 miles.
Parents and other family members attend and can join in too. After completing, everyone receives a medal and soon after the event children bring in their sponsorship forms.
In school, a PSHE lesson will be dedicated to learning about Cancer Research and why we support the cause. Children are given time to create their poster of who they are running for, in remembrance of and attach it to themselves.
